Spelling Bee Prep for Families – Fall 2023
GRADES 3-8 AND THEIR GROWN-UPS: Are you interested in spelling bee competitions? Do you love to spell and learn the meaning of new words? This is a workshop for students who are interested in participating in their school’s spelling bee, as well as their parents/guardians. We will learn words from other languages, reference spelling bee movies and books, play games, and host a mock spelling bee.
Elise Mandel holds a master’s degree in education from the University of Massachusetts, Amherst. She teaches classes and works with private students in many subjects.
